.mulch-calc__area{background:var(--color-bg-secondary);border-radius:var(--radius-md);padding:var(--space-4);border:1px solid #00000014}.mulch-calc__area-header{margin-bottom:var(--space-2);justify-content:space-between;align-items:center;display:flex}.mulch-calc__area-title{font-family:var(--font-heading);font-size:var(--text-base);font-weight:var(--font-bold);color:var(--color-text-primary)}.mulch-calc__area-remove{width:24px;height:24px;font-size:var(--text-lg);color:var(--color-text-muted);border-radius:var(--radius-sm);transition:color var(--transition-fast),background-color var(--transition-fast);justify-content:center;align-items:center;line-height:1;display:flex}.mulch-calc__area-remove:hover{color:var(--color-text-primary);background-color:#0000000f}.mulch-calc__area-stat{font-family:var(--font-body);font-size:var(--text-sm);color:var(--color-text-muted);line-height:1.5}.mulch-calc__area-yards{color:var(--color-text-primary);font-weight:600}.mulch-calc__area-price{font-family:var(--font-heading);font-size:var(--text-sm);font-weight:var(--font-bold);color:var(--color-text-accent);margin-top:var(--space-1)}.mulch-calc__delivery-fee{font-family:var(--font-heading);font-size:var(--text-2xl);font-weight:var(--font-bold);color:var(--color-text-accent);display:block}.mulch-calc__delivery-distance{font-family:var(--font-body);font-size:var(--text-sm);color:var(--color-text-muted);margin-top:var(--space-1);display:block}.mulch-calc__inner[data-astro-cid-fc2skmpi]{max-width:var(--container-max);padding-inline:var(--container-padding);padding-block:var(--section-padding-y);gap:var(--space-16);grid-template-columns:1fr 1fr;align-items:start;margin-inline:auto;display:grid}.mulch-calc__heading[data-astro-cid-fc2skmpi]{font-family:var(--font-heading);font-size:var(--text-2xl);font-weight:var(--font-bold);color:var(--color-text-primary);padding-bottom:var(--space-4);border-bottom:2px solid var(--color-border);margin-bottom:var(--space-6)}.mulch-calc__form[data-astro-cid-fc2skmpi],.mulch-calc__delivery-form[data-astro-cid-fc2skmpi]{gap:var(--space-4);flex-direction:column;display:flex}.mulch-calc__field[data-astro-cid-fc2skmpi]{gap:var(--space-2);flex-direction:column;display:flex}.mulch-calc__label[data-astro-cid-fc2skmpi]{font-family:var(--font-heading);font-size:var(--text-sm);font-weight:var(--font-semibold);color:var(--color-text-primary)}.mulch-calc__sqft-hint[data-astro-cid-fc2skmpi]{font-family:var(--font-body);font-size:var(--text-sm);color:var(--color-text-muted);margin-top:var(--space-1)}.mulch-calc__submit-row[data-astro-cid-fc2skmpi]{align-items:center;gap:var(--space-4);display:flex}.mulch-calc__areas[data-astro-cid-fc2skmpi]{gap:var(--space-3);margin-top:var(--space-5);flex-direction:column;display:flex}.mulch-calc__total[data-astro-cid-fc2skmpi]{margin-top:var(--space-4);padding-top:var(--space-4);border-top:2px solid var(--color-border);font-family:var(--font-heading);font-size:var(--text-lg);font-weight:var(--font-bold);color:var(--color-text-primary)}.mulch-calc__total-price[data-astro-cid-fc2skmpi]{color:var(--color-text-accent)}.mulch-calc__delivery-actions[data-astro-cid-fc2skmpi]{gap:var(--space-3);display:flex}.mulch-calc__delivery-result[data-astro-cid-fc2skmpi]{font-family:var(--font-body);font-size:var(--text-base);color:var(--color-text-primary);min-height:1.5em}.mulch-calc__contact[data-astro-cid-fc2skmpi]{margin-top:var(--space-8)}.mulch-calc__contact-heading[data-astro-cid-fc2skmpi]{font-family:var(--font-heading);font-size:var(--text-xl);font-weight:var(--font-bold);color:var(--color-text-primary);margin-bottom:var(--space-3)}.mulch-calc__contact-list[data-astro-cid-fc2skmpi]{gap:var(--space-2);font-family:var(--font-body);font-size:var(--text-base);color:var(--color-text-primary);flex-direction:column;margin:0;padding:0;line-height:1.6;list-style:none;display:flex}.mulch-calc__contact-list[data-astro-cid-fc2skmpi] a[data-astro-cid-fc2skmpi]{color:var(--color-text-accent);text-decoration:none}.mulch-calc__contact-list[data-astro-cid-fc2skmpi] a[data-astro-cid-fc2skmpi][data-astro-cid-fc2skmpi]:hover{text-decoration:underline}@media(width<=767px){.mulch-calc__inner[data-astro-cid-fc2skmpi]{gap:var(--space-10);grid-template-columns:1fr}}.mulch-faq__inner[data-astro-cid-e5ieq72i]{max-width:var(--container-max);padding-inline:var(--container-padding);padding-bottom:var(--section-padding-y);margin-inline:auto}.mulch-faq__heading[data-astro-cid-e5ieq72i]{font-family:var(--font-heading);font-size:var(--text-2xl);font-weight:var(--font-bold);color:var(--color-text-primary);padding-bottom:var(--space-4);border-bottom:2px solid var(--color-border);margin-bottom:var(--space-8)}.mulch-faq__grid[data-astro-cid-e5ieq72i]{gap:var(--space-8) var(--space-16);grid-template-columns:1fr 1fr;display:grid}.mulch-faq__item[data-astro-cid-e5ieq72i]{gap:var(--space-3);flex-direction:column;display:flex}.mulch-faq__question[data-astro-cid-e5ieq72i]{align-items:flex-start;gap:var(--space-3);font-family:var(--font-heading);font-size:var(--text-base);font-weight:var(--font-bold);color:var(--color-text-primary);display:flex}.mulch-faq__number[data-astro-cid-e5ieq72i]{background-color:var(--color-bg-accent);color:#fff;border-radius:var(--radius-full);width:24px;height:24px;font-size:var(--text-xs);font-weight:var(--font-bold);flex-shrink:0;justify-content:center;align-items:center;margin-top:1px;display:flex}.mulch-faq__answer[data-astro-cid-e5ieq72i]{font-family:var(--font-body);font-size:var(--text-base);color:var(--color-text-primary);padding-left:calc(24px + var(--space-3));line-height:1.7}@media(width<=767px){.mulch-faq__grid[data-astro-cid-e5ieq72i]{grid-template-columns:1fr}.mulch-faq__answer[data-astro-cid-e5ieq72i]{padding-left:0}}
